Aller au contenu

moimichel

Actif
  • Compteur de contenus

    24
  • Inscrit(e) le

  • Dernière visite

Messages postés par moimichel

  1. Tout dépend comment tu as fait ta redirection ? Apache, PHP, dans la page ?

    Pas de redirection mais un frame...pas réalisé par moi!!

    <FRAMESET rows='100%,*' FRAMEBORDER='0' FRAMEBORDER='0' BORDER=0 FRAMESPACING='0'>
    <FRAME SRC='http://www.elpower.it' NAME='top' BORDER=0 FRAMESPACING='0' FRAMEBORDER='0' NORESIZE SCROLLING='AUTO'>
    <FRAME SRC='' NAME='bottom' BORDER=0 FRAMESPACING='0' FRAMEBORDER='0' NORESIZE SCROLLING='NO'>
    <noframes>
    <body bgcolor='#FFFFFF' text='#000000' link='#0000FF' vlink='#CC0000' alink='#00CC33'>
    <font face='Verdana'>
    <p> <p> <p><a href='http://www.elpower.it'>http://www.elpower.it</a><p> <p> <p> 
    </font>
    </body>
    </noframes>
    </FRAMESET>

    ça fait longtemps qu'il est en ligne ton site ?

    novembre 2008

  2. Réponse à Leonick :

    Pas de problème : il y a toujours des petits drapeaux qui obligent mon site à utiliser la langue choisie par le client et rien que celle la!!!

    Je ne voulais pas rentrer dans les détails sur ce sujet, mais si ça intéresse je peux indiquer la procédure utilisée. ($_SESSION combinié avec $_GET ).

    Merci Cariboo!!

    Comment envoyer le code 301 au lieu du 302 (par défaut) ??

  3. Bonjour,

    Pour créer un site en plusierus langues, je détecte la langue du browser ($_SERVER["HTTP_ACCEPT_LANGUAGE"]) et selon la réponse je redirige vers une ou autre directory du genre : /fr, /es, /en et ainsi de suite...

    Pour cette redirection j'utilise

    header("Location : fr/monfichier.php") pour la partie française
    header("Location : en/monfichier.php") pour la partie anglaise
    et ainsi de suite...

    Questions :

    1. Est-ce la meilleure façon de procéder??

    2. La fonction header("Location : ") renvoie un code 302. Google apprécie?? Il n'en tient pas compte?? Aucune importance, mon site sera indexé de toutes façons???

    Merci d'avance à tous.

    PS: Si vous pouvez m'indiquer des resources, des idées (XHTML, CSS, PHP) pour créer un site en plusieurs langues, je suis preneur.

  4. Sacré Daniel...

    En lisant tes messages, je suis de plus en plus convaincu que modx a un beau futur devant: je m'y suis mis à fond de mon coté pour l'utiliser. J'étais douteux entre modx et textpattern.

    Revenons à nos moutons pour ce qui est de la création d'un double menu (horizontal et vertical) avec modx. J'aimerais à la fin créer un petit tutoriel qui pourrait etre util pour les "n.e.w.b..i.e.s" comme moi.

    Voila comment je crée mes 2 "div" contenant les 2 menus .

    <div id="top_menu">
    [[DropMenu? &levelLimit=`1` &hereClass=`active_top`]]
    </div>

    <div id="sub_menu">
    [[DropMenu? &maxLevel=`1` &startDoc=[[UltimateParent]] &hereClass=`active_sub`]]
    </div>

    Dans le deuxième menu (le latéral) j'utilise un snippet "UltimatParent" qui détermine le répertoire appelant .

    Dans chaque répertoire j'introduis ce snippet "FirstChildRedirect pour afficher la page correspondante au premier point du menu latéral....

    Ca me parait un scénario plutot courant dans le web. Donc je crois que ça vaut la peine d'y passer un peu de temps.

    A+

  5. Voivi la solution pour l'affichage de la première page correspondante au menu latéral :

    introduisez ce snippet FirstChildRedirect dans le contenu correspondant au répertoire appelant.

    Si c'est pas tres clair n'hésitez pas à me laisser un message pour un example.

    Je commence petit à petit à apprécier modx!!! Bien que pour le moment, il y peu d'ambiance autour du projet.

    Michel.

  6. Salut,

    Comment puis je créer un menu horizontal et vertical sous modx.

    Sachant que le menu vertical change selon le choix qui a été fait sur le menu horizontal.

    Je crois que la solution se trouve dans la valeur a passer à startDoc dans le snipet DropMenu.

    Comment puis passer une valeur à startDoc dépendante du point d'appel?

    Merci d'avance.

    Michel

  7. J' ai un problème avec des div que j'essaye d'empiler les uns sur les autres et ainsi faire corrspondre les ombres extérieures. Sur IE6 pas de problèmes, ça marche; firefox rien à faire. pourquoi?

    Votre aide SVP.

    le lien : cliquez ici

    ou le code :


    <style type="text/css">
    #container {
    position: absolute;
    left: 10px;
    top: 10px; }
    #c01 {
    width: 322px;
    height: 119px;
    background: url(centrale.jpg) no-repeat; }
    #title {
    /*color: #FFFFFF;*/
    left: 10px;
    top: 65px; }
    #c02 {
    margin: 0;
    padding: 0;
    width: 322px;
    height: auto;
    background: #FFFFFF url(laterale.jpg) repeat-y right top; }
    #c03 {
    width: 322px;
    height: 10px;
    background: url(piede.jpg) no-repeat; }
    .testi {
    margin: 15px; }
    </style>
    </head>
    <body>
    <div id="container">
    <div id="c01">
    <h2 id="title">Title of the page</h2></div>
    <div id="c02">
    <h2 class="testi"><span>Lorem</span></h2>
    <p class="testi">Lorem ipsum dolor sit amet, consectetuer adipiscing elit. Duis ligula lorem, consequat eget, tristique nec, auctor quis, purus. Vivamus ut sem. Fusce aliquam nunc vitae purus. Aenean viverra malesuada libero. Fusce ac quam. Donec neque. Nunc venenatis enim nec quam. Cras faucibus, justo vel accumsan aliquam, tellus dui fringilla quam, in condimentum augue lorem non tellus.</p>
    </div>
    <div id="c03"></div>
    </div>
    </body>
    </html>

    Merci d'avance.

    Michel, Florence.

×
×
  • Créer...